Output f2c70389318898820a5cea24ee9d1c68ceaee317d15eb891a41330cd394277da:28

value
275481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86cbda636187499530fabbcf292f29b08b17008f OP_EQUAL
address
3DykgD6DpCN7JsrrNAbkV48Ps5w6uGkPVe
transaction
f2c70389318898820a5cea24ee9d1c68ceaee317d15eb891a41330cd394277da
confirmations
183691
spent
true